Arizona man pretended to be a doctor, charged with 48 felony counts: officials
Fox News
Arizona resident Jose Andres Lopez has been charged with 48 felony counts for allegedly impersonating a doctor and forging documents. Authorities are searching for his victims.
State officials are now looking for clients who were "treated" by Lopez at the Institute for Male Health and Performance in Lake Havasu City. Officials believe he may have "practiced" under the name Dr. Joseph Lopez.
Lopez's charges include computer tampering, taking the identity of another and forgery. Officials say that the offenses took place between 2017 and 2021.
